Podcast Description
The Own Your Path Series is a virtual event designed for Native youth, and featuring conversations with inspiring Indigenous leaders and trailblazers. Their stories and advice are aimed at motivating Native youth to embrace their unique paths with confidence.

In this episode of Own Your Path, we sit down with acclaimed Native author and storyteller Tommy Orange for a powerful conversation about the role of storytelling, identity, and community in the lives of Native youth.
Hosted by the Lindy Waters III Foundation, this conversation is part of an ongoing series created to uplift and inspire Indigenous youth as they carve out their own paths to success.
🎧 What You’ll Hear:
How storytelling strengthens Native communities
Personal insights on identity, resilience, and belonging
Advice for young Indigenous leaders navigating today’s world
The importance of building a strong, supportive community
